> Your package build-depends on gcc >= 4.7. This dependency is not 
> satisfiable on powerpc, s390x, sparc and ia64.
> 
> If you want to use a gcc version other than the default for an 
> architecture then you must depend on it directly (not via the gcc 
> dependency package) and then invoke it by it's versioned name.

It seems to me that removing "g++ (>= 4:4.7~)" from Build-Depends: in
debian/control should be sufficient.
